(-) Description

Title :  CRYSTAL STRUCTURE OF THE CLOSED CONFORMATION OF BACILLUS DNA POLYMERASE I FRAGMENT BOUND TO DNA AND DCTP
 
Authors :  S. J. Johnson, J. S. Taylor, L. S. Beese
Date :  24 May 02  (Deposition) - 25 Mar 03  (Release) - 24 Feb 09  (Revision)
Method :  X-RAY DIFFRACTION
Resolution :  1.95
Chains :  Asym. Unit :  A,B,C,D,E,F
Biol. Unit 1:  A,C,D  (1x)
Biol. Unit 2:  B,E,F  (1x)
Keywords :  Dna Polymerase I, Dna Replication, Klenow Fragment, Protein- Dna-Dntp Complex, Closed Conformation, Transferase/Dna Complex (Keyword Search: [Gene Ontology, PubMed, Web (Google))
 
Reference :  S. J. Johnson, J. S. Taylor, L. S. Beese
Processive Dna Synthesis Observed In A Polymerase Crystal Suggests A Mechanism For The Prevention Of Frameshift Mutations
Proc. Natl. Acad. Sci. Usa V. 100 3895 2003
PubMed-ID: 12649320  |  Reference-DOI: 10.1073/PNAS.0630532100

(-) Related Entries Specified in the PDB File

1l3s 1L3S IS THE WILD TYPE BACILLUS DNA POLYMERASE I BOUND TO A 9 BASE PAIR DNA DUPLEX IN THE OPEN CONFORMATION
1l3t 1L3T IS A 10 BASE PAIR PROTEIN-DNA PRODUCT COMPLEX, PRODUCED BY PLACING A CRYSTAL OF THE 9 BASE PAIR COMPLEX (1L3S) IN A STABILIZATION SOLUTION CONTAINING DTTP.
1l3u 1L3U IS AN 11 BASE PAIR PROTEIN-DNA PRODUCT COMPLEX, PRODUCED BY PLACING A CRYSTAL OF THE 9 BASE PAIR COMPLEX (1L3S) IN A STABILIZATION SOLUTION CONTAINING DTTP AND DATP.
1l3v 1L3V IS A 15 BASE PAIR PROTEIN-DNA PRODUCT COMPLEX, PRODUCED BY PLACING A CRYSTAL OF THE 9 BASE PAIR COMPLEX (1L3S) IN A STABILIZATION SOLUTION CONTAINING DTTP, DATP, DCTP, AND DGTP.
1l5u 1L5U IS A 12 BASE PAIR PROTEIN-DNA PRODUCT COMPLEX, PRODUCED BY PLACING A CRYSTAL OF THE 9 BASE PAIR COMPLEX (1L3S) IN A STABILIZATION SOLUTION CONTAINING DTTP, DATP, AND DCTP.
